4bb4234781422b9cd35ebd62f791f26ee631e48080b5e1a5dfb48eed33392ba6

1550940 (138011 blocks ago)

⏴ Block 1550939 (32a32a6f...7da) | Block 1550941 ⏵ | Latest block ⏭

Metadata

28/3/24, 6:02 pm UTC (191d 16:23:26 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details